Why Miami Music Week Hits Harder Than Most Festival Weeks

Most major events are one or two nights of intensity. Miami Music Week is different because it compounds. March heat, humidity,
walking between venues, long rides, inconsistent meals, and repeated late nights create cumulative stress. You might start one day
at a pool party, bounce to dinner in Brickell, close at Space, then try to reset in a few hours before heading to another daytime event.
Repeat that cycle across a full week, and your body is not just tired, it is depleted.

The MMW circuit is also fragmented across neighborhoods and venues. People move between SLS, Delano, 1 Hotel, and Fontainebleau,
then jump into night runs at Space, E11even, LIV, Story, or Treehouse. That hotel-hopping and venue-hopping means more time in transit,
more steps in the heat, less consistent hydration, and very little actual recovery time. Even if your schedule looks fun on paper, the
physiological load is high. Dehydration, headache, fatigue, and brain fog often show up before the week is halfway done.

Add international travel and time-zone shifts, and many guests arrive already partially dehydrated. Long flights into Miami, alcohol,
caffeine, sun exposure, and reduced sleep stack quickly. This is exactly why dedicated IV support during Miami Music Week is no longer
just a luxury for artists and VIP tables. It is a practical tool for people who want to enjoy the full week without losing multiple days
to recovery.

How to Pace All 7 Days Without Burning Out by Day Four

Most people underestimate the accumulation effect. You can feel “fine” after one night and still be trending toward a crash because
hydration and sleep debt are building underneath the surface. The smartest MMW strategy is not perfection. It is controlled pacing.

Simple recovery rules that make a major difference:

  1. Front-load hydration daily: Start each day with water and electrolytes before coffee and before alcohol.
  2. Schedule recovery windows: Block at least one solid reset period between daytime and nighttime plans.
  3. Do not wait for total crash: Book support when symptoms begin, not after they are severe.
  4. Protect one sleep cycle: Even one better night can stabilize the next 24 hours significantly.
  5. Eat consistently: Long gaps between meals amplify hangover and fatigue symptoms.

If you are aiming to enjoy all seven days, proactive recovery beats reactive rescue every time. Clients who schedule one strategic IV
earlier in the week often avoid the full breakdown pattern we see around day four and day five.
